Union royal commission 'a farce'

Dyson Heydon's guest speaker booking at a Liberal party fundraiser shows he is 'conflicted and biased' says Labor's Tony Burke.

The former judge charged with overseeing the royal commission into union corruption has been billed as guest speaker at a Liberal Party fundraiser.

The Coalition's marathon same-sex marriage debate ended in a short-term fix which has reignited internal doubts about the Prime Minister's judgement and leadership.

Two thirds of the joint party room supported traditional marriage and binding MPs and Senators to the status quo.
